Dear Natural Health Friends, Laura and I have been spending a lot of time lately studying what’s really going on with so many of the chronic health challenges we see in the office. One issue that keeps showing up is something often called “Leaky Gut” — or more accurately, a compromised gut barrier. Your gut lining is meant to act like a smart, selective barrier. Dear Natural Health Friends, I came across a post this week from Dr. AmmousMD that really made me stop and think. He explained that your body relies on UV signals reaching your eyes to trigger melanin production—the pigment that gives you a tan and helps protect your skin from burning. When you block those signals with sunglasses, you may actually increase your risk of sunburn because your body doesn’t get the message to ramp up its natural defense.
